The Department of Industry, Innovation and Science is a department of the Australian Government responsible for consolidating the Government’s efforts to drive economic growth, productivity and competitiveness by bringing together industry, energy, resources and science.

The head of the department is the Secretary of the Department of Industry, Innovation and Science, presently Glenys Beauchamp; who reports to the Minister for Industry, Innovation and Science, presently Senator the Hon. Arthur Sinodinos, and the Minister for Resources and Northern Australia, the Hon. Matthew Canavan MP. The ministers are assisted by the Assistant Minister for Industry, Innovation and Science, the Hon. Craig Laundy MP.

History

Following the appointment of Malcolm Turnbull as prime minister, the Department of Industry, Innovation and Science was established on 21 September 2015, taking on the functions of the previous Department of Industry and Science.

Scope

As outlined in the Administrative Arrangements Orders, the department is responsible for a wide range of functions including:

  • Manufacturing and commerce including industry and market development
  • Industry innovation policy and technology diffusion
  • Construction industry, excluding workplace relations
  • Facilitation of the development of service industries generally
  • Trade marks, plant breeders’ rights and patents of inventions and designs
  • Anti-dumping
  • Civil space issues
  • Science policy
  • Energy policy
